To provide shelter?  A roof over your head? Security at night from wolves and thieves? A place to stash your stuff?  Yes, maybe, all those things and more. 

But also this: a place to dream in peace. 

I talked to her about Gaston Bachelard and his idea that the purpose of a house was that it allowed one to dream in peace.

 

Source: Adam Nicolson, Sissinghurst: An unfinished history (London: Harper Press, 2009), p. 162
